In the application of industrial Internet of Things,Cellular Gateway (Industrial IoT Gateway) and 4G cellular modem (data transmission unit) play an important role.It is used to connect sensors and cloud platforms, and realize data acquisition and transmission.In this article, we will compare Cellular Gateway and 4G cellular modem, and discuss their respective advantages and differences.
Cellular Gateway is an intermediary device connecting sensors and cloud platforms, with the ability of data acquisition, conversion and transmission.It plays a key role in the industrial environment, and its advantages are mainly reflected in the following aspects.
Cellular Gateway can connect to a variety of different types of sensors and devices.Realize the interconnection and intercommunication of heterogeneous systems.It has the support of a variety of communication protocols, so that devices of different brands and protocols can achieve data interaction.
Cellular Gateway has certain data processing and analysis capabilities.The collected data can be processed in real time, format conversion, compression and other operations.This can reduce the burden of the cloud and improve the efficiency and reliability of data transmission.
Cellular Gateway includes security measures such as data encryption, authentication, and access control.Ensure data security and privacy protection.It can establish a secure connection between the device and the cloud, and transmit and store data securely.
A 4G cellular modem is a device for data transmission and communication,It is mainly used to transmit sensor data to the central server through the network.The 4G cellular modem has unique advantages over the Cellular Gateway in the following areas.
4G cellular modems are typically plug-and-play and relatively simple to install and configure.Complicated programming and configuration processes are not required. This makes 4G cellular modems easier to apply and deploy in simple scenarios.
Most 4G cellular modems are designed with low power consumption, which can effectively save energy and prolong the service life of equipment.For some scenarios with limited power supply, the low power consumption of 4G cellular modem is particularly important.
The price of 4G cellular modem is relatively low compared to Cellular Gateway.Making it more competitive in some cost-sensitive applications.
In addition to data transmission, Cellular Gateway also has the ability of data processing and analysis.The 4G cellular modem, on the other hand, focuses on data transmission and communication.
Cellular Gateway is mainly used in complex industrial environments to connect multiple devices and systems.It also provides functions such as data processing and cloud docking.The 4G cellular modem is more suitable for some simple scenarios, such as home automation, power monitoring and so on.
Cellular Gateway usually has higher technical requirements, requiring more computing and processing power.Support for complex protocols and extended interfaces. The 4G cellular modem, on the other hand, is relatively simple and focuses more on simple installation and use.
Cellular Gateway and 4G cellular modem have their own advantages and characteristics in industrial Internet of Things applications.Cellular Gateway is powerful, suitable for complex industrial environments, with data processing and analysis capabilities;The 4G cellular modem, on the other hand, is simple to use, suitable for some simple scenarios, and relatively inexpensive.The selection of appropriate equipment needs to be determined according to specific needs and application scenarios in order to achieve the best data transmission and communication effect.Cellular Gateway and 4G cellular modem will continue to play an important role with the development of industrial Internet of Things technology.Promote the process of industrial automation and intelligence.
